Female Physicians and the Future of Endocrinology
Type:
Briefs and Summaries
70% of current endocrinology fellows are women, which reflects an apparent waning of interest in endocrinology among male trainees. To continue to attract trainees to the specialty and support their success, it is imperative that challenges in the workplace be recognized, understood, and addressed. The following literature review examines this gender shift by exploring topics of professional satisfaction, work-life balance, income, parenthood, academic success, and patient satisfaction.
